Output 6c3f28394b4263f156f680ba25489aaf19c219c52630ae99ce7b5d5b0e890b96:6

value
25300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ff98f686c03e2383ac1354d58af6065cbe14bc3 OP_EQUAL
address
3DMghembHw2eJj3gpKa4jcQRB2Kj5cvSqb
transaction
6c3f28394b4263f156f680ba25489aaf19c219c52630ae99ce7b5d5b0e890b96
spent
true